Hey Ben, thank you for your inquiry. We have researched your model and found that if your microwave is making a humming noise, you may have a problem with the magnetron. This component is part of the high voltage circuit and provides the microwaves that generate the heat. If the magnetron is defective, it may cause a loud humming or buzzing noise. We recommend you change its magnetron, part number FIX12705729. If you require assistance to place an order, please contact customer service. We hope that helps!
Hi, what do i have to remove to get at the fuse in this model ? Thank you
For model number LFMV164QFA
Hi Doug, thank you for contacting us. The fuse is located on a fuse board on the right side of the unit, behind the control panel. Once the power has been disconnected, the microwave will need to be set on a flat surface. The vent grill and microwave cover will need to be removed to access the fuse located at the top of the right-hand side. The appliance will hold a charge that can be dangerous, even with the appliance unplugged. We advise using caution. We hope this information helps!

Remove vent cover then remove touch screen control panel. When you remove control panel take photo of where everything is plugged in then unplug and remove control panel. 3 door switches located next to door in a plastic chassis. Test each switch with current tester. Remove the bad switch and replace with the new one. You tube DIY helped.
